    Miele Hybrid S4812 and Eco Line S4212

    I spent much of yesterday at the beautiful new Miele Gallery in Cavendish Square, London, for a preview of their latest cleaners, the Hybrid S4812, and the Eco Line S4212. Based on the S4, the Hybrid introduces a new patented technology which allows the user to switch seamlessly between mains...

    Exhibition update

    Hi Charles Richard - the lower motor vents you mention seem to appear exclusively on 240v machines - my guess would be that Hoover engineers were concerned about keeping the new 360w motor cool when running on a higher current. The same lower vents were also used on the 825; later 825s had...
